【问题标题】:How to add new line in ion-option tag?如何在离子选项标签中添加新行?
【发布时间】:2019-05-23 18:00:17
【问题描述】:

需要在下拉列表中的公司名称后换行。

我什么都试过了,也插入<p> & <br> 标签。

<ion-item>
    <ion-label>select</ion-label>
    <ion-select okText="Okay" cancelText="Dismiss">
    <ion-option value="1"> company1 address1</ion-option>
    <ion-option value="2">company2  address1</ion-option>
    <ion-option value="2">company3 address3</ion-option>
    <ion-option value="4">company4 address4</ion-option>
    </ion-select>
 </ion-item>

我想在新行中显示一个地址。我也在公司和地址之间尝试了一个 HTML 标签。公司和地址是两个不同的文本。

使用标签后,显示在同一行。

更新:我知道 HTML 标签在 ion-option 中不起作用。有没有人在 ionic 中遇到过同样的事情。

【问题讨论】:

    标签: ionic-framework


    【解决方案1】:

    将html注入离子元素有点尴尬,但你可以绕过它

    css.

    page-home {
        .select-text{
            white-space: normal;
            width: min-content;
            word-spacing: 9999px;
        }
    }
    

    好好讨论一下Can CSS force a line break after each word in an element?

    希望对你有帮助

    【讨论】:

      猜你喜欢
      • 1970-01-01
      • 2017-10-22
      • 2019-08-31
      • 2014-11-13
      • 2019-10-03
      • 1970-01-01
      • 1970-01-01
      • 2021-11-18
      • 2014-08-20
      相关资源
      最近更新 更多